The quality of components is really high. Especially compared to usb connectors you can get from sites like aliexpress, I was really impressed with the push-down-style terminals and how they fit together with the thickness of the wires and their isolation.
The length of the paracord was really quite accurate. For those who dont know, paracord and cable do not have the same diameter. Paracord is usually always a bit thinner than a four string copper cable like usb uses. So the longer the desired total length of the cable is, the longer the paracord needs to be relative to the cable . I'd say, my paracord was about half an inch too long, but at a total length of 6 feet and for a mass production product, this is basically PERFECT.
Also the melting of the paracord ends is also as good as it possible can be. Just to explain, if you melt too much, the end becomes one giant glob of plastic, if you dont melt enough, the paracord seperates its self into its individual strings in no time.

My only real critizism is not related to the product, but to the product page here on massdrop and the video it is showing. The video details the cable layout of a usb b MINI connector, not MICRO. Micro has a mirrored layout compared to mini. If you just follow allong with the video and dont pay attention to the type of connector, your computer starts beeping as soon as you plug in a device with the cable and your device will not work. Reading only the last page of this dicussion thread, this error happened to A LOT of people.
